# W. Spiegel, 2003-12-08
# walter.spiegelweb.de
# http://www.wspiegel.de/gfsqlite
# Beispiele zur SQL-Anleitung
# sql_02.html
# PS: Zeilen mit # am Anfang werden (hoffentlich!) berlesen
pysql> SELECT * FROM sar_schueler;
# Spalten der Tabelle sar_schueler anzeigen
pysql> desc sar_schueler;
pysql> SELECT name,vorname,geschlecht,klasse,schuelernr FROM sar_schueler;
pysql> SELECT schuelernr FROM sar_wahl;
# nur unterschiedliche schuelernr anzeigen
pysql> SELECT DISTINCT schuelernr FROM sar_wahl;
# Zeilen ordnen
pysql> SELECT DISTINCT schuelernr FROM sar_wahl
	ORDER BY schuelernr;
pysql> SELECT DISTINCT schuelernr FROM sar_wahl
	ORDER BY schuelernr DESC;
pysql> SELECT schuelernr,prowonr
      FROM  sar_wahl
      ORDER BY 1,2;
# Selektion
pysql> SELECT name,vorname FROM sar_lehrer
             WHERE name='Spiegel';
pysql> SELECT name,vorname FROM sar_lehrer
             WHERE name='igel';
# Beispiele zum Join-Befehl
pysql> SELECT name, thema
      FROM sar_lehrer, sar_projekt;
pysql> SELECT name, thema
      FROM sar_lehrer, sar_projekt
      WHERE sar_lehrer.prowonr = sar_projekt.prowonr;
pysql> SELECT name, thema
      FROM sar_lehrer, sar_projekt
      WHERE sar_lehrer.prowonr = sar_projekt.prowonr
      ORDER BY name DESC;
pysql> SELECT name, thema
      FROM sar_lehrer AS l, sar_projekt AS p
      WHERE l.prowonr = p.prowonr;

